Job Summary


To oversee, direct, and evaluate the overall administration, supervision, and coordination of the interscholastic athletic programs for the school.


Essential Duties

  • Direct and evaluate the learning experiences of students in extracurricular activities.
  • Provide guidance to students which will promote educational development.
  • Foster effective communication with parents and/or guardians.
  • Cooperate with and participate in the planning, implementation, and evaluation of the total school program.
  • Follow District and South Carolina School League (SCHSL) guidelines when recommending all coaching assignments to the principal for approval.
  • Prepare athletic budget, requisition supplies and equipment, supervise expenditures, prepare all purchase orders, maintain inventories, and report receipts for all activities by administering the athletic program fairly and equitably.
  • Interpret eligibility policies to students, parents, and the community and with the cooperation of the principal, enforce eligibility standards and policies as developed by the SCHSL and District.
  • Assist coaches with tryout procedures and with the development of team procedures and guidelines.
  • Explain district policies, including Title IX compliance, in detail to all new coaches and review policies with all coaches.
  • Ensure all new coaches attend the District's introductory coaching staff development course.
  • Explain SCHSL rules and policies to all new coaches.
  • Review disciplinary policies with all new coaches.
  • Work with the administration for recruitment and selection of staff members who would also serve in a coaching capacity.
  • Regularly supervise practices and games.
  • Complete yearly coaching evaluations with school administration.
  • Complete all other responsibilities associated with the program or assigned by the principal on a daily basis.
  • Manage all athletic contests. This includes before game preparation, after game responsibilities, depositing of gate receipts and preparation for out-of-town contests.
  • Act as the school liaison with the Athletic Booster Club.
  • Coordinate all team travel and transportation.
  • Responsible for student recordkeeping for athletic eligibility.
  • Participate in professional development activities required within the school, district and state.

Job Specifications

Performance of this job will be evaluated annually in accordance with the District's evaluation procedures.



Minimum Qualifications (Knowledge,

Skills and Abilities

Required)

  • Masters Degree in Education, Educational Leadership, Business Administration, or comparable area from an accredited college or university.
  • Experience as a Coach.
  • Able to communicate effectively.
  • Experience in implementing system-wide support programs.
  • Experience in implementing and achieving results through a district-wide strategic plan.
  • Such alternatives to the above qualifications as the Board may find appropriate and acceptable.
